Bollywood actress Shilpa Shetty, known for her lavish and devotional Ganpati celebrations every year, has announced that she will not be holding the festivities this year. The actress, who welcomes Lord Ganesha into her home annually with grandeur and deep faith, shared the update through her Instagram stories.
In her note, Shilpa expressed grief and explained the reason behind the decision. “Dear friends, With deep grief we regret to inform you, Due to a bereavement in the family, this year we will not be holding our Ganpati celebrations,” read her statement.
Shilpa Shetty will not celebrate Ganesh Chaturthi this year due to family bereavement, issues statementShe further added that the Kundra family would be observing a mourning period in line with tradition. “As per tradition, we will be observing a mourning period of 13 days and will therefore refrain from any religious festivities. We seek your understanding and prayers. With gratitude – The Kundra Family,” she wrote.
While bidding farewell to Bappa in her message, Shilpa captioned her post with the devotional chant: “Ganpati bappa morya, pudchyavarshi lav kar ya” (O Lord Ganesha, come back soon next year).
Over the years, Shilpa has been admired not just for her acting but also for the way she celebrates Ganesh Chaturthi, inviting fans and friends into her festive world filled with devotion, colour, and joy. Her announcement this year marks a rare pause in that cherished tradition, as she and her family dedicate time to mourning their personal loss.
On the professional front, Shilpa was last seen in Sukhee, directed by Sonal Joshi in her debut. The film is a lighthearted yet meaningful slice-of-life drama that follows the journey of Sukhpreet “Sukhee” Kalra, a 38-year-old Punjabi homemaker who rediscovers herself during a trip to Delhi for her high school reunion. Through a week of adventures, Sukhee rediscovers her spark, transitioning from a dutiful wife and mother to embracing her individuality as a woman.
Next, Shilpa will be seen in KD: The Devil, a Kannada action drama helmed by director Prem. The film boasts an ensemble cast including Dhruva Sarja, Sanjay Dutt, V. Ravichandran, Ramesh Aravind, Nora Fatehi, and Reeshma Nanaiah.
Meanwhile, her husband Raj Kundra is gearing up for his appearance in the Punjabi film Mehar. The story follows Karamjit, a man from rural Punjab, as he battles to reclaim his lost dignity and prove his worth to his family despite life’s adversities.
